New York 22
October 16, 1962

Dear Mr. Sawyer:
It was very thoughtful of you indeed, to have forwarded to me the catalogue with the expression of your appreciation towards the dealers who have assisted you in the formation of your Museum's collection.

This is a remarkable document, for it reveals the exceptional group of works of art which your acumen succeeded in bringing together in so short a time. Particular Striking, of course, are the diversified fields it covers.

Writing makes me realize that I have not had the pleasure of seeing you in quite a while and do hope that you will have an opportunity of dropping in on one of your next visits East.

With renewed appreciation and with best personal greetings,
sincerely yours,
Germain Seligman

Mr. Charles H. Sawyer
Director
Museum of Art
University of Michigan
Ann Arbor, Michigan
